Antonio Ray O’Brien, age 18, of Jellico, Tennessee passed away Friday, April 26, 2024, at UT Medical Center.
He was born December 22, 2005, in Jellico, Tennessee. Antonio was a senior at the Jellico High School.
Antonio is preceded in death by his father, Elvis O’Brien; and grandparents, Earl and Cynthia Delk.
He is survived by his mother, Lexie (Delk) Roberts and husband Christopher; grandmother, Joie (O’Brien) Hutson; brother, Bryson Brown; sisters, Brittany Gaylor and husband Aaron, Michaela O’Brien and Chase Hurst and their unborn baby; uncle, John “Bobby” Delk; close family member, Jamie Brown; and a host of friends and family to mourn his passing.
The funeral was Thursday, May 2, at the Harp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Anthony Lawson officiating.
Burial followed in the Kensee Cemetery in Williamsburg, Kentucky.
Harp Funeral Home of Jellico in charge of arrangements.
